Our Approach
How Vinx Controls Mosquitoes in Your Columbia Yard
Property Inspection & Breeding Site Assessment
Your technician walks the full property to identify mosquito resting areas (dense vegetation, shaded shrubs, wood piles) and standing water breeding sites such as gutters, low spots, ornamental pots, and tarps. A targeted treatment plan is built around what is actually driving mosquito pressure on your property.
Yard Treatment
A fine-mist application of residual insecticide is applied to the underside of shrubs, lower tree canopies, tall grass, fence lines, and other resting areas. The treatment kills active mosquitoes on contact and provides a residual effect that continues working for 3–4 weeks between monthly service visits.
Larvicide Application
Larvicide tablets or liquid is applied to any standing water that cannot be eliminated, retention areas, drainage ditches, decorative ponds. Larvicide prevents mosquito larvae from maturing into biting adults and continues working for 30 days, breaking the breeding cycle between visits.
Monthly Service & Free Re-Treatments
Monthly visits maintain continuous pressure on the mosquito population throughout the season. If mosquito activity returns within the service period, we come back and re-treat at no additional charge. Your technician also recommends property modifications (drainage corrections, vegetation management) that reduce long-term mosquito pressure.

Blythewood Mosquito Pressure
Why Mosquito Control in Blythewood Isn’t One-Size-Fits-All
Blythewood’s mosquito pressure is genuinely tracked at the county level: Richland County Vector Control runs an active mosquito spraying program and monitors for West Nile virus, and a Richland County-based academic study has specifically examined the ecological factors driving West Nile transmission risk locally. That county-wide effort targets roadways and public land, but it doesn’t reach standing water or vegetation on private property, which is where most residential mosquito pressure actually starts.
Cobblestone Park and Longcreek Plantation’s golf-course ponds, including those tied to the Windermere Club course, create steady stagnant water that favors Southern house mosquitoes, the species most closely linked to West Nile virus locally. That same species turns up near the Scout Motors and I-77 Exit 27 corridor, where construction-related excavation and disturbed drainage collect standing water. Meanwhile, the older, shaded properties along the historic Blythewood Road corridor and the wooded lots near Kelly Mill Road give Asian tiger mosquitoes plenty of harborage close to home.
2 Mosquito Species Common to Blythewood
Asian Tiger Mosquito (Aedes albopictus)
Recognizable by the single white stripe down its back, this aggressive daytime biter rarely travels more than a few hundred feet from where it hatched. It breeds in almost any container that holds water for more than a few days, as well as natural tree holes. The mature shade trees along the historic Blythewood Road corridor and the wooded lots near Kelly Mill Road give it plenty of harborage close to home.
Southern House Mosquito (Culex quinquefasciatus)
Active from dusk to dawn, this species breeds in larger volumes of stagnant, often organically rich water. Golf-course pond edges throughout Cobblestone Park and Longcreek Plantation and construction-related standing water near the Scout Motors and I-77 corridor are genuine local sources. It is the primary mosquito species associated with West Nile virus transmission in the region, which is why Richland County Vector Control specifically monitors for it and why larvicide treatment is a key part of controlling it.
Mosquito Pressure by Neighborhood
Know Your Blythewood Neighborhood’s Mosquito Risk
Blythewood Road & Hoffman House Historic Corridor: Asian Tiger Mosquitoes
Mature shade trees and older landscaping around the historic downtown core give Asian tiger mosquitoes plenty of shaded harborage and small containers to breed in. Daytime biting near shaded porches and older trees is the most common complaint in this corridor. Dumping standing water from plant saucers, gutters, and tree hollows is the single biggest prevention step homeowners here can take.
Cobblestone Park Corridor: Southern House Mosquitoes
Golf-course pond edges throughout this community create the stagnant water conditions Southern house mosquitoes prefer. Evening swarms near pond-adjacent lots are the most common complaint. Larvicide treatment at pond edges, combined with barrier spray on surrounding vegetation, is the most effective approach. Richland County Vector Control’s public spraying reaches roadways but not the private pond edges where most pressure originates.
Longcreek Plantation Corridor: Southern House Mosquitoes
Ponds tied to the Windermere Club course and other common-area water features create the same stagnant-water mosquito pressure found in Cobblestone Park. Evening activity near back-yard pond-adjacent lots is the predominant complaint. Monthly barrier treatment during the March–October season is the most reliable solution for homes in this corridor.
Scout Motors & I-77 Exit 27 Corridor: Southern House Mosquitoes
Construction-related excavation and disturbed drainage near the incoming Scout Motors plant collect standing water that creates favorable breeding conditions for Southern house mosquitoes. This is an actively evolving issue tied to ongoing major construction. Properties close to the corridor should consider perimeter barrier treatment and larvicide for any standing water on or adjacent to the property.
Kelly Mill Road & Rural Fairfield County Line Corridor: Asian Tiger Mosquitoes
Wooded lots and natural tree holes in this rural stretch of town give Asian tiger mosquitoes ample outdoor breeding sites close to home. Daytime biting near wooded property edges is the primary complaint. Tree-hole treatment and removal of any small containers holding water significantly reduce pressure on these larger rural lots.
